Back in February, I had a 1cc fill, bringing me up to 6.8cc in my 10cc band. I definitely had restriction and couldn't eat much but still felt fine. I took a trip to Wales in March and was tight the entire time but managed to eat a bit and wasn't PBing. Then I got back and I started having this constant nagging pain in my stomach...like where my actual stomach is..to the left side kind of up under my ribs. Anyway, I went to my doctor and he said it was because I wasn't cutting up my pills small enough and it was irritating the pouch. So I started cutting them up and the pain actually did finally subside.
During April/May I started feeling like I was getting hungry quicker and eating a bit more so I scheduled a fill and went in on May 21st. The doctor put in .3cc but under fluoro said it looked like I was a bit too tight so he took back out .1cc and left me with 7cc total. Over the next week I was REALLY tight. I didn't have any pain but I was PBing constantly. Not even liquids would stay down. So I went in for a partial unfill. They took out 1cc leaving me with only 6cc total. It was instant relief though.
During the time I was only at 6cc, I didn't feel like I had hardly any restriction at all. I was having to really watch my calorie intake and use a hell of a lot of willpower. Which only works for so long for me.
